One hundred sixty-six years after his birth, José Martí is still present.
Georgetown, 26 January 2019. The National Hero of Cuba, José Martí Pérez, was born on January 28, 1853, his life and work transcend our borders, he is recognized as the most universal of Cubans, thus was remembered in an act celebrated in the headquarters of the Cuban Embassy in Guyana with the presence of collaborators of health and education in this sister nation, Cuban residents, friends of solidarity and workers of the Cuban Embassy.
The Cuban Ambassador Narciso Reinaldo Amador Socorro, recalled that Marti's thought today is fully valid against the imperialist onslaught on our lands of America, at the insistence of the United States to seize Cuba, in the attempt of coup d'etat to the sister Republic of Venezuela to which he ratified the total support of our country.
